MongoDB
 sql >> Database >  >> NoSQL >> MongoDB

SQLite locale vs MongoDB remoto

Uno dei principali rischi dell'approccio SQLite è che con l'aumento dei requisiti di scalabilità, non sarà possibile eseguire (facilmente) la distribuzione su più server di applicazioni. Potresti essere in grado di suddividere i tuoi utenti in server separati, ma se quel server si interrompesse, avresti un sottoinsieme di utenti che non potrebbero accedere ai loro dati.

L'uso di MongoDB (o di qualsiasi altro servizio centralizzato) allevia questo problema, poiché i tuoi server web sono stateless:possono essere aggiunti o rimossi in qualsiasi momento per adattarsi al carico web senza doversi preoccupare di quali dati si trovano e dove.